Output 86bf1013c1897240d6cd3908fe73b4c53e0ffe04d50497f7be3d89f4d29b2d38:23

value
4011762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8278b49b1e10526c92dc722fc7178e101c57de4e OP_EQUAL
address
3DatNFErp4EE1ntogKNZR7XnwQRQsDi5dN
transaction
86bf1013c1897240d6cd3908fe73b4c53e0ffe04d50497f7be3d89f4d29b2d38
spent
true